Fell and grind x 1 Lime tree (T1) -as Lime tree is in the middle of the driveway, the base of the trunk has overtime been buried as the ground level has been bought up with the tarmac driveway and has also obtained compaction damage from this. The tree is declining heavily and has signs of internal decay which could lead to stability issues and very little vitality in the crown and showing signs of dieback. Lift group of approx 10 x trees comprising of mixed species of Sycamore, Ash and Lime on boundary to clear 5m.
